Everyone not born in Michigan, may seek United States citizenship though the process of naturalization. This usually means fulfilling a list of requirements in order to become a citizen. These requirements vary depending on the applicant. Usually, everyone must be a legal permanent resident, reside in the country for a given period of time, pass a test on U.S. history and law, and maintain good moral character.
